Zena Suri Alpacas
Zena Suri Alpacas raises suri alpacas on a 78-acre ranch in Jay, Oklahoma, near the shores of Grand Lake O' the Cherokees in far northeastern Oklahoma — roughly an hour northeast of Tulsa.
Kathleen and Tom Callan run the operation with a focus on full Peruvian genetics, breeding animals across a wide range of the 22 recognized alpaca colors. The program emphasizes fine, lustrous fleece alongside easy-to-handle temperaments, and while the herd does not compete heavily on the halter show circuit, its fleece is regularly submitted to spin-offs held throughout the country.
Buyers looking for suri alpacas for sale in Oklahoma will find a herd-oriented approach here that extends beyond the sale itself. The ranch offers complimentary handling and care classes to new owners, and mentorship is part of how the Callans approach each placement. In addition to breeding animals, the farm produces suri yarn and fiber goods made from its own herd, all processed in the United States.
